首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Powershell中CSV的时间去反跳过滤器

在Powershell中,CSV(Comma-Separated Values)是一种常用的文件格式,用于存储和交换数据。CSV文件由逗号分隔的文本行组成,每行表示一个数据记录,每个字段之间用逗号分隔。

时间去反跳过过滤器是指在处理CSV文件时,根据时间字段进行筛选和过滤数据的操作。具体来说,时间去反跳过过滤器可以根据指定的时间范围,将CSV文件中的数据按照时间进行筛选,只保留符合条件的数据记录。

在Powershell中,可以使用Import-Csv命令将CSV文件导入为一个Powershell对象,然后使用Where-Object命令结合时间去反跳过过滤器来筛选数据。以下是一个示例:

代码语言:txt
复制
# 导入CSV文件
$data = Import-Csv -Path "C:\path\to\file.csv"

# 设置时间范围
$startTime = Get-Date "2022-01-01"
$endTime = Get-Date "2022-12-31"

# 使用时间去反跳过过滤器筛选数据
$filteredData = $data | Where-Object { $_.Time -ge $startTime -and $_.Time -le $endTime }

# 输出筛选后的数据
$filteredData

在上述示例中,我们首先使用Import-Csv命令将CSV文件导入为一个Powershell对象,然后使用Where-Object命令结合时间范围来筛选数据。$_.Time表示CSV文件中的时间字段,-ge表示大于等于,-le表示小于等于。最后,我们将筛选后的数据存储在$filteredData变量中,并输出结果。

对于Powershell中CSV的时间去反跳过滤器,腾讯云并没有特定的产品或服务与之直接相关。然而,腾讯云提供了丰富的云计算服务和解决方案,可以帮助开发者构建和管理各种应用程序和系统。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券